Guard Units To Be Home By Christmas

The commander of the Vermont National Guard says 1,500 soldiers are leaving Afghanistan earlier than scheduled and should be in Vermont for the holidays.

Maj. Gen. Michael Dubie says the return schedule for the Vermont Guard troops stationed in Afghanistan is moving up, and he’s optimistic everyone will be home by Christmas.

Dubie he’s looking forward to seeing more family reunions like one last week, when five Vermont National Guardsmen successfully completed their mission in Afghanistan. Another 40 are due home today.

After that, Dubie says, hundreds of soldiers will be coming back every couple of days.
